Monthly climate in Mogok, Myanmar

Last updated: July 31, 2025

Under the Köppen–Geiger climate classification Mogok features a humid subtropical climate (Cwa). Temperatures typically range between 17 °C (62 °F) and 26 °C (79 °F) through the year, but rarely can drop to 5 °C (42 °F) or can rise to as high as 37 °C (99 °F). The average annual precipitation amounts to about 2345 mm (92.3 inches) and receives 209 rainy days on the 1 mm (0.04 inches) threshold annually. Mogok enjoys an average of 3537 hours of sunshine throughout the year, and daylight varies from 10 hours 44 minutes to 13 hours 30 minutes per day.

Monthly average temperatures in Mogok, Myanmar

The warmest months in Mogok are May, June and July, with daily mean temperatures ranging from 26 to 26 °C (78 - 79 °F) throughout the day. The coldest temperatures usually occur in January, February and December, when daily mean temperatures range from 17 to 19 °C (62 - 66 °F) throughout the day. On average each year, Mogok experiences 282 days above 25 °C (77.0 °F) and 0 days below 0 °C (32.0 °F).

Monthly average precipitation in Mogok, Myanmar

Mogok usually has the most precipitation in June, August and September, with an average of 29 rainy days and 378 mm (14.9 inches) of precipitation per month. The driest months in Mogok are February, March and December. On average, 18 mm (0.7 inches) of precipitation falls during these months.

Monthly sunshine hours in Mogok, Myanmar

The sunniest months in Mogok are March, April and May, when the sun shines an average of 11 hours 1 minutes a day. Least sunny months in Mogok: January, July and August receive an average of 8 hours 12 minutes of sunshine daily.

Solar UV radiation in Mogok, Myanmar

Mogok experiences the highest level of ultraviolet (UV) radiation in July, August and September, when the maximum UV index can reach values of 13 - 14, which corresponds to the Extreme category of sun exposure. January, February and December are in the High / Very High exposure category. In these months, the maximum values of the UV index do not exceed 9.
